INGREDIENTS
- 3 cups old-fashioned oats
- 2 cups quick oats
- 1 cup chopped walnuts, pecans, sliced almonds, sunflower seeds or any other favorite nuts/seeds
- ½ cup toasted wheat germ
- ¼ cup maple syrup
- 2 tablespoons Mazola® Corn Oil
- 2 tablespoons Spice Islands Pure Vanilla Extract
- 4 teaspoons Spice Islands Ground Saigon Cinnamon
- ½ teaspoon Spice Islands Ground Nutmeg
- 1 cup dried chopped apricots, tart cherries, cranberries, raisins or any other favorite dried fruit
DIRECTIONS
- Combine oats, nuts and wheat germ in a large bowl.
- Combine maple syrup, corn oil, vanilla, cinnamon and nutmeg in a small bowl.
- Pour over oat mixture, stirring to coat.
- Spread mixture evenly on greased rimmed baking pan/sheet.
- Bake at 300°F for 50 to 60 minutes, stirring every 15 minutes, until oats are toasted.
- Remove from oven and stir in dried fruit.
- Cool in pan on wire rack. Store in airtight container.
Makes about 2 quarts (8 cups) or 16 servings of ½-cup each.
